摘要
This paper gives brief idea about design and development of SPWM's three-step voltage source inverter. PWM is mainly applied to many industrial applications in which good performance is required. The SPWM pulses is produced by comparing reference signal and carrier signal that is sinusoidal wave and triangular wave. When the amplitude of sine wave is greater than triangular wave then pulses starts produce to high and when amplitude of triangular signal is greater than sine signal then pulses will come to low. The output of SPWM is changed by changing modulation index, frequency. The inverter output with SPWM gives lower Total Harmonic Distortion.
